Has there been any recall for the alternator of the 2014 Honda CR-V?

The 2014 Honda CR-V has not been subject to a recall concerning the alternator. However, there have been recurring issues with the alternator, so it is likely that you may need to have it repaired at some point during the car's lifespan. On the bright side, there is a technical service bulletin (TSB) related to this vehicle. The TSB serves as a notice to inform you about common problems and how to address them if they arise. If the alternator does fail, the cost of repair is around $500. If you can demonstrate that the alternator failed due to a fault on Honda's part, they may offer a replacement, though proving this can be challenging.

    While the 2014 Honda CRV has faced problems with charging, Honda has only released a Technical Service Bulletin regarding this issue. To find out if your vehicle is impacted, verify your VIN number with your nearest dealer.
